Magic is a nudge to help your own actions be more effective. Magic/ancestors/deities aren't vending machines were you put something in to get something out.
Moldavite is/was a social media trend created to push the stone to buyers. I'm a rock hound and I'll consistently see an abundance of material hit the collector market and then 4-6 months later it's suddenly this miracle worker crystal that everyone MUST have.

What is your expectation with these practices?
What is your understanding of how magic works.
I've been doing psychic, energy work, and witchcraft for 25+ years. These are just my experiences based on life experience.
Law of assumption or law of attraction primarily is a misleading paradigm. It often punishes people for not doing better/ more and blames people for their trauma or hardships. I personally find it misguided and innthe realm of toxic positivity. It sounds good initially and empowering, but it's also disconnected from reality.
I would say we "co-create" our reality. Meaning there are things we can change or work towards and then there are things outside of our control.
This blends more into my definition of how magic works. Magic nudges. It doesn't make fantastical changes. Fantastical changes are outside of witchcraft but in terms of magic it would be more like miracles. Which typically are like "Divine interventions" things that are mysterious and also greater than one person.
So do I think there is anything wrong with you?
No.
I suspect you got dupped into magical new age thinking. Which has always been around but it's also wide spread on social media because it sells a good lie. Energy and magic work but it subtle. It's not a miracle. If something sounds too good to be true, it probably is. Money spells work best for instance when you're applying to jobs. You have to give magic something to nudge. Money doesn't just fall in people's laps. That's not how the world works.
Life is hard. There is an uphill battle for most people to be successful. Our thoughts don't manifest everything. Hope that helps.
